the structural integrity of the interior grill parts, exterior, and drip pans are warranted to be free from defects in material and
workmanship, when subjected to normal domestic use and service, for a period of five years from the date of purchase. This
warranty is limited to the replacement of the defective parts, with the owner paying all other cost including labor.
